![]() ![]() You can upgrade your mana farm along the way but you'll see rapidly diminishing returns. So you have between wave 70 and wave 190 to build a killer gem towards the end of your path uninterrupted. If you've never done mana farming like this you will be blown away by how quickly the bar fills.ģ level 13 gems surrounded by 6 level 13 amplifiers will be able to take you to about wave 190 before anything is able to get through. It will automatically cast when the mana bar fills and extend your pool at the fastest possible rate. Protip: At this point you should shift-click the extend mana pool spell. You can extend the mana farm as far as you want but this small one will get the job done, cost very little (comparatively), and most laptops will struggle to run smoothly even with just these 3. ![]() I can usually get to level 12 or 13 for all gems by wave 70 or so. Because you gain mana so fast you can upgrade extremely quickly. This setup will get you mana at an extremely high rate as the mana gain is also applied to the multiple hits lime gives you. The trap gems should be 2-4 grades higher than the amplifiers. I typically use a straight section of path and set up 3 traps with lime/orange gems that are surrounded by amplifiers on each side (6 total) with L/O gems. If there is more than 1 entrance for monsters put it just after their paths converge. What you need to do is build a mana farm at the beginning of the level. By wave 100 your mana pool should be around 250-300k ![]()
